DIY - Tissue Holder

My family love Pinkberry's yogurt! We buy their take home tub so whenever we crave for it all we need to do is open the ref.

The tub is so cute I can't force myself to throw it away.  Here's a DIY-recycling-upcycling tissue holder that Julia and I made.


It's so easy to make, all you need: old magazines, glue, scissors, arts and crafts  material (optional). 

1. Make sure you wash the inside of the tub with soap and water quickly because it's made of paper. Do not wet the outside of the tub.

2. Choose the theme (if you wish to), if not, cut out any pictures that you like. 


Because I like inspiring quotes, I chose it as my design/theme.


Julia's theme is all about Mom and Kids



For the cover, poke a hole and cut a circle, then design (if you wish to)
